just ask for your days.

and don't rent weekend points - weekend are Fri/Sat - not sat/sun.

Sun-thurs is your best rental days.

It is 13 points Sun-thurs for a studio in May - so it will be somewhere around $130 per night.

fri/sat are 29 points so $290 per night.

remember points won't do you any good - you need a reservation. If they can't get you your reservation then go to someone else.

spiceycat, why are you saying not to rent points on a weekend? Just cause of the cost, or would it be cheaper to pay cash for those nights?
 
You can use the May 2005 charts for a May 2006 stay. There will be no difference.

Sorry the link does't work. I'm sure they will have it fixed soon.

Usually, it will cost you less to reserve Friday and Saturday nights through CRO than it will to rent points for those nights from a DVC member - especially if you can snag a discount. However, you should do the math for yourself because that is not always true. For example, it's not true for a May 2006 stay in a studio at the BWV or BCV if you have to pay rack rate and can rent points for $13 or less each.

Rack rate for May, 2006 for a studio at either the BCV or the BWV is $384.68 per night including tax. You can get a studio weeknight for 13 points and a weekend night for 29 points.

Even if you have to pay $13 per point, you will pay $$377/weekend night if you rent points. (No additional tax or fee is owed when you rent points). If you can find points for $10/point, that Friday and Saturday night will run you $290/night. To make paying cash a better deal for the weekend nights with points at $10 each, you'd have to get a 25% discount from rack. I don't think the discounts have been that good lately. Welcome! If you know what type of accomodations you want: studio or 1 or 2 bdrms, you can request point totals for that. Of course, a range of dates is necessary to check points too. The going rate seems to be $10-$11 per point. To book a May vacation before 7 months out, you'll need to rent points from someone with BCV points available. Within 7 months, you can rent points from other DVC owners.
